One Thing You Must Do

Extract from The Truth Is

Edited by Prashanti de Jager, page 176

There is one thing you must do

so as not to be tricked by the mind,

Simply keep Quiet and do not make effort.

What you mention is making effort, but you are requested not to make any kind of effort and to keep quiet. If you ask me how to keep Quiet, I will ask you not to think. If you ask me how not to think then I will suggest that you find out where the thought arises from. Turn your face towards That. Do not look at the object of the mind, but to where the mind arises from. Mind is a bundle of thoughts and there is no difference between thought and “I.” When “I” arises thought arises and when thought arises senses arise and they produce objects of their respective senses. Eyes to see, nose to smell a flower, ears to hear music, tongue to taste and hands to touch. These are the objects of the senses  but the senses and the objects are the same. When the senses are there, objects are there. Now return back slowly to where the senses arise from. They arise from mind. Objects-senses-mind. Where does the mind rise from? Ego! There is no difference between mind and ego. Where does the Ego arise from? This means where does the “I” arise from. Pick this up. When you do you will merge into that place where “I” arises and disappears — and that situation is yet undescribed by anyone, no teacher or preacher or religious book or Sutra or the Buddha.
